Here's my take on the Begins costume. It was sculpted with Chavant NSP soft green clay and cast in silicone rubber.

Chest sculpt..

This is still the sculpture but I sprayed it with several layers of black satin prior to molding it to give it a light 'sandy mist' texture. It's very faint, but needed to help distinguish the glass smooth chest bat logo.

With the bat logo I did the opposite...I made it uber glass smooth so that it would stand out on the cast rubber costume. The suit is all black, but when you get different finishes in the sculpture it naturally forces the illusion of different tones being used.
